Use Case Applications:

  • Cold chain monitoring: The Adeunis TEMP 2S temperature probe sensor can be used to monitor the temperature of perishable goods during transportation and storage. This is particularly useful in the food and pharmaceutical industries where maintaining a specific temperature range is critical to ensure product quality and safety.
  • HVAC monitoring: The temperature probe sensor can be used to monitor the temperature of HVAC systems in commercial buildings. This can help facility managers optimize energy usage and identify potential issues before they become major problems.
  • Industrial process monitoring: The temperature probe sensor can be used to monitor the temperature of industrial processes such as chemical reactions, manufacturing processes, and storage facilities. This can help ensure that processes are running at optimal temperatures and prevent damage to equipment or products.
